Jeff Severson is viewed as a solid prospect entering the 1971 NFL Draft. His physical attributes and experience suggest he has the potential to develop into a reliable starter at the offensive tackle position. While there are areas for improvement, particularly in technique and consistency, his college performance indicates he possesses the raw talent necessary to succeed at the professional level.
Projected Draft Round:Expected to be selected in the mid to late rounds, with potential for a team looking for a developmental tackle who can contribute in the future.
